Subject: ntp: config file contains invalid directive
Package: ntp
Version: 1:4.2.4p4+dfsg-3
Severity: normal


The standard install of ntp.conf contains an incorrect directive.

logdir /var/log/ntpd

is not correct.

logfile /var/log/ntpd

works, as per the documentation distributed with ntp-doc.
